Tigray’s Education Bureau has launched a new general education curriculum framework, replacing a framework that had been in use for 16 years.
The bureau said the change is intended for the coming academic year, but warned that shortages of funding and textbooks could constrain implementation. The rollout therefore pairs a significant policy change with immediate questions about whether schools will have the materials needed to apply it consistently.
The development was reported on August 19, 2026, by Addis Standard through AllAfrica. Further details on financing, textbook distribution and the timetable for implementation were not available in the source item.
